The Connection Between Bruxism and Neck Pain

Bruxism, the involuntary grinding or clenching of teeth, primarily occurs during sleep but can also happen while awake. This repetitive jaw movement exerts tremendous pressure on the muscles controlling the jaw, face, and head. It’s no surprise that this strain doesn’t stop at the jaw itself. The muscles in the neck and upper shoulders often bear the brunt of this tension, leading to discomfort or persistent pain.

The jaw muscles, especially the masseter and temporalis, are closely linked to the neck’s musculature through connective tissues and nerve pathways. When these jaw muscles tighten excessively due to bruxism, they can pull on surrounding structures, causing referred pain in the neck area. This domino effect explains why many people with bruxism report stiffness or soreness in their necks upon waking.

How Muscle Tension Spreads From Jaw to Neck

Muscle tension rarely stays localized when it’s chronic. In bruxism cases, continuous clenching causes microtraumas in muscle fibers and tendons around the jaw joint (temporomandibular joint or TMJ). The body reacts by tightening nearby muscles to protect against further injury. Unfortunately, this protective mechanism often backfires.

The sternocleidomastoid and trapezius muscles in the neck respond to increased tension from the jaw by contracting themselves. Over time, these contractions lead to fatigue and trigger points—small knots of tight muscle fibers that cause pain. This cascade of muscle strain explains why a problem that starts with teeth grinding can result in persistent neck discomfort.

Signs That Bruxism Is Causing Neck Pain

Identifying whether your neck pain stems from bruxism involves recognizing certain symptoms that often accompany teeth grinding:

    • Morning stiffness: Waking up with a sore or stiff neck is a classic sign.
    • Jaw soreness: Tenderness around the TMJ or difficulty opening your mouth fully.
    • Headaches: Tension headaches originating near temples or base of skull.
    • Ear discomfort: A feeling of fullness or mild earache without infection.
    • Visible teeth wear: Flattened or chipped teeth from grinding.

If you notice these symptoms together, it’s a strong indicator that your neck pain might be linked to bruxism rather than other causes like poor posture or cervical spine issues.

The Role of Sleep Quality

Sleep quality plays a crucial role here. Bruxism often disrupts restful sleep cycles due to micro-arousals triggered by grinding episodes. These interruptions prevent proper muscle relaxation overnight. Without adequate recovery time during sleep, muscle tension accumulates not just in your jaw but also spreads to your neck and shoulders.

Poor sleep also lowers your threshold for pain perception, meaning even mild muscle tightness can feel more intense after restless nights. Thus, bruxism-induced sleep disruptions create a vicious cycle where pain worsens over time.

The Science Behind Bruxism-Induced Neck Pain

Understanding how bruxism translates into neck pain requires diving into anatomy and neurology. The TMJ connects your lower jawbone to your skull near your ear and is surrounded by muscles responsible for chewing and jaw movement. These muscles share neural pathways with those controlling head and neck posture.

When bruxism causes hyperactivity in these muscles, it triggers an increase in nociceptive signals—pain signals sent to the brain—from both the jaw and adjacent areas like the cervical spine. This phenomenon is called referred pain: discomfort felt at a site distant from its actual source.

Research shows that patients with chronic bruxism frequently report increased tenderness not only at their jaws but also along their upper trapezius muscles—a major muscle spanning from your neck down to your shoulders. Electromyography (EMG) studies confirm heightened muscle activity in these regions during periods of intense teeth grinding.

A Closer Look at Muscle Fatigue

Muscle fatigue occurs when prolonged contraction limits blood flow and oxygen delivery within muscle tissues. In bruxers, constant clenching reduces circulation in both jaw and neck muscles. This leads to accumulation of metabolic waste products like lactic acid that irritate nerves and cause inflammation.

Over time, this inflammation sensitizes nerve endings further amplifying pain signals—a process known as peripheral sensitization. The result? Chronic aching sensations not only localized at the jaw but radiating down into the cervical region as well.

Treatment Options Targeting Bruxism-Related Neck Pain

Addressing bruxism-induced neck pain requires a multi-pronged approach focusing on reducing teeth grinding while relieving muscle tension:

Mouthguards and Splints

Dental appliances such as night guards provide a physical barrier between upper and lower teeth during sleep. They help redistribute biting forces evenly across teeth surfaces reducing pressure on specific areas prone to damage.

By lessening clenching intensity, mouthguards decrease excessive load on jaw muscles which indirectly reduces strain transferred to neck musculature.

Physical Therapy Techniques

Targeted exercises focusing on stretching and strengthening cervical spine muscles improve posture while releasing tightness caused by bruxism-related tension. Manual therapy methods like massage or myofascial release can break down trigger points within affected muscles easing discomfort significantly.

Postural training is crucial since poor head alignment exacerbates muscle strain around TMJ and cervical spine junctions.

Stress Management Strategies

Stress is one of the primary triggers for awake bruxism episodes. Techniques such as mindfulness meditation, biofeedback therapy, or cognitive behavioral therapy (CBT) can reduce anxiety levels leading to fewer involuntary clenching incidents throughout day or night.

Relaxation methods promote overall muscular relaxation including those in jaws and neck thereby minimizing secondary pain symptoms.

Medications for Muscle Relaxation

In some cases where conservative measures fail, physicians might prescribe short-term muscle relaxants or anti-inflammatory medications aimed at reducing acute symptoms linked with severe bruxism flare-ups.

These drugs help interrupt painful spasms within tight musculature but are generally used alongside other therapies for long-term relief rather than as standalone solutions.

Lifestyle Adjustments That Help Reduce Symptoms

Simple changes can make a big difference in managing both bruxism and its related neck pain:

    • Avoid stimulants: Caffeine and nicotine increase nervous system activity which may worsen grinding habits.
    • Create calming bedtime routines: Activities like reading or gentle stretching encourage relaxation before sleep.
    • Avoid chewing gum: Excessive chewing keeps jaw muscles active unnecessarily increasing fatigue risk.
    • Maintain good posture: Keep head aligned over shoulders especially during screen use.
    • Avoid hard foods: Eating tough items places extra load on already strained masticatory muscles.

These tweaks reduce overall muscular workload allowing both jaws and neck more opportunity for rest throughout day/night cycles.

The Importance of Professional Diagnosis

While self-observation helps recognize patterns linking bruxism with neck pain, professional evaluation ensures accuracy before starting treatment plans:

    • Dentists specialize in diagnosing signs of tooth wear related to grinding.
    • TMD (temporomandibular disorder) specialists assess joint function alongside muscular health.
    • Physical therapists evaluate muscular imbalances contributing to symptoms extending beyond jaws into cervical region.
    • Sleeps studies may be recommended if nocturnal bruxism suspected but unconfirmed.

Getting an expert opinion prevents misdiagnosis which could delay appropriate interventions allowing symptoms like neck pain to worsen unnecessarily.

The Long-Term Impact If Left Untreated

Ignoring chronic bruxism doesn’t just risk worsening dental damage; it can lead to persistent musculoskeletal problems affecting quality of life:

    • TMD progression: Untreated grinding accelerates joint degeneration causing chronic facial pain beyond just initial discomfort.
    • Cervical spine issues: Ongoing muscular imbalance may contribute toward disc degeneration or nerve impingement over time.
    • Sustained headaches: Persistent tension headaches reduce productivity impacting daily functioning severely.
    • Poor sleep quality: Continuous disruption leads to daytime fatigue compounding stress levels creating feedback loops worsening both conditions.

Early intervention breaks this cycle preventing minor annoyances from becoming disabling conditions requiring complex treatments later on.
